I'm borrowing a 40X at the moment, been shooting it for months now. I swap it into my AICS for the perfect trainer.
It shoots Eley Target sub moa. Down at the OTC, it'll put 60 shots in a row into 1/2" at 50m. It'd put them all into 3/8" if the driver didn't stink.
You don't need a canted base for 100y, but I think you'll eventually want to shoot it longer. I have a 20 moa base on my Savage trainer, and that gets me to about 250 yards with the same Eley ammo. If I had it to do over, I'd get 25 or 30 moa. Get all the elevation you can in the scope, you'll need it if you do decide to go long.
Wolf ammo also has a good reputation, as do some other I can't seem to recall at the moment. Check the rimfire section at the hide.
I'm buying the Eley at just under $50 for 500. I can probably get some for you if you like.
